STATE v. STEIN

No. 57265.

504 S.W.2d 1 (1974)

STATE of Missouri, Respondent, v. Richard Lee STEIN, Appellant.

Supreme Court of Missouri, Division No. 2.

January 14, 1974.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John C. Danforth, Atty. Gen., Jefferson City, Charles B. Blackmar, Sp. Asst. Atty. Gen., St. Louis, for respondent.

John P. Haley, Jr., Kansas City, for appellant.


HOUSER, Commissioner.

On August 31, 1971 Richard Lee Stein filed a notice of appeal from the judgment and sentence entered upon a jury verdict finding him guilty of assault with intent to kill with malice aforethought and fixing his punishment at 15 years' imprisonment.
